5,000 anti-personnel mines seized in Kandahar

KANDAHAR CITY (PAN): Nearly 5,000 anti-personnel landmines were seized by border police in the Shorabak district of southern Kandahar province, an official said on Saturday.

The mines were received from two tractors in the Zali area of the district, the governor’s spokesman, Zalmai Ayubi, told Pajhwok Afghan News. The drivers were killed during a clash with police.

He said 200 firecrackers and 2,000 kilograms explosives were also seized from the vehicles.
